# Pikewater Autoscaler — Environments

The queue-depth autoscaler runs in dev, staging, and prod. Dev scales on a 1-minute window; staging and prod use 5 minutes. Scale-down is deliberately slow to avoid thrash. Never edit thresholds directly in prod — change the manifest and redeploy. The current per-environment values are listed below.

service settings:
[casax]
port = 6379
team = rusir
host = casax.zemvarhq.corp
region = outer-4
access_code = ac_9808ce
timeout_ms = 1500

## Formula sandbox tuning

User-supplied formulas in Gridmoor execute inside a restricted interpreter with hard ceilings on time, memory, and call depth. Reviewers should confirm any change to these ceilings is justified in the PR description, since raising them widens the abuse surface. Defaults were chosen from production traces. The current limits are as follows.

limits module of tafog-fawip:
WEIGHTS = {
    "julix": 57,
    "lamys": 992,
    "kasvan": 209,
    "quenok": 750,
    "alddor": 259,
    "oliath": 1009,
    "wenix": 815,
}

## Vendor Note: Ormway Refactor

The legacy ORM layer from Cindermark Systems is out of support as of Q3. Their replacement SDK changes transaction semantics; review every save-path diff carefully. We are not renewing the maintenance contract, so patches to the old layer must be in-house. Flag any vendor-generated code in PRs — licensing restricts redistribution. Questions about contract scope or the migration timeline go to our vendor liaison.

escalation mailbox, bafog-fafog: ulador@paliqlabs.internal